# Copyright (c) Microsoft. All rights reserved.
|
|
|
|
"""
|
|
MCP Tool via YAML Declaration
|
|
|
|
This sample demonstrates how to create agents with MCP (Model Context Protocol)
|
|
tools using YAML declarations and the declarative AgentFactory.
|
|
|
|
Key Features Demonstrated:
|
|
1. Loading agent definitions from YAML using AgentFactory
|
|
2. Configuring MCP tools with different authentication methods:
|
|
- API key authentication (OpenAI.Responses provider)
|
|
- Azure AI Foundry connection references (AzureAI.ProjectProvider)
|
|
|
|
Authentication Options:
|
|
- OpenAI.Responses: Supports inline API key auth via headers
|
|
- AzureAI.ProjectProvider: Uses Foundry connections for secure credential storage
|
|
(no secrets passed in API calls - connection name references pre-configured auth)
|
|
|
|
Prerequisites:
|
|
- `pip install agent-framework-openai agent-framework-declarative --pre`
|
|
- For OpenAI example: Set OPENAI_API_KEY and GITHUB_PAT environment variables
|
|
- For Azure AI example: Set up a Foundry connection in your Azure AI project
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
import asyncio
|
|
|
|
from agent_framework.declarative import AgentFactory
|
|
from dotenv import load_dotenv
|
|
|
|
# Load environment variables
|
|
load_dotenv()
|
|
|
|
# Example 1: OpenAI.Responses with API key authentication
|
|
# Uses inline API key - suitable for OpenAI provider which supports headers
|
|
YAML_OPENAI_WITH_API_KEY = """
|
|
kind: Prompt
|
|
name: GitHubAgent
|
|
displayName: GitHub Assistant
|
|
description: An agent that can interact with GitHub using the MCP protocol
|
|
instructions: |
|
|
You are a helpful assistant that can interact with GitHub.
|
|
You can search for repositories, read file contents, and check issues.
|
|
Always be clear about what operations you're performing.
|
|
|
|
model:
|
|
id: gpt-4o
|
|
provider: OpenAI.Responses # Uses OpenAI's Responses API (requires OPENAI_API_KEY env var)
|
|
|
|
tools:
|
|
- kind: mcp
|
|
name: github-mcp
|
|
description: GitHub MCP tool for repository operations
|
|
url: https://api.githubcopilot.com/mcp/
|
|
connection:
|
|
kind: key
|
|
apiKey: =Env.GITHUB_PAT # PowerFx syntax to read from environment variable
|
|
approvalMode: never
|
|
allowedTools:
|
|
- get_file_contents
|
|
- get_me
|
|
- search_repositories
|
|
- search_code
|
|
- list_issues
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
# Example 2: Azure AI with Foundry connection reference
|
|
# No secrets in YAML - references a pre-configured Foundry connection by name
|
|
# The connection stores credentials securely in Azure AI Foundry
|
|
YAML_AZURE_AI_WITH_FOUNDRY_CONNECTION = """
|
|
kind: Prompt
|
|
name: GitHubAgent
|
|
displayName: GitHub Assistant
|
|
description: An agent that can interact with GitHub using the MCP protocol
|
|
instructions: |
|
|
You are a helpful assistant that can interact with GitHub.
|
|
You can search for repositories, read file contents, and check issues.
|
|
Always be clear about what operations you're performing.
|
|
|
|
model:
|
|
id: gpt-4o
|
|
provider: AzureAI.ProjectProvider
|
|
|
|
tools:
|
|
- kind: mcp
|
|
name: github-mcp
|
|
description: GitHub MCP tool for repository operations
|
|
url: https://api.githubcopilot.com/mcp/
|
|
connection:
|
|
kind: remote
|
|
authenticationMode: oauth
|
|
name: github-mcp-oauth-connection # References a Foundry connection
|
|
approvalMode: never
|
|
allowedTools:
|
|
- get_file_contents
|
|
- get_me
|
|
- search_repositories
|
|
- search_code
|
|
- list_issues
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
|
|
async def run_openai_example():
|
|
"""Run the OpenAI.Responses example with API key auth."""
|
|
print("=" * 60)
|
|
print("Example 1: OpenAI.Responses with API Key Authentication")
|
|
print("=" * 60)
|
|
|
|
factory = AgentFactory(
|
|
safe_mode=False, # Allow PowerFx env var resolution (=Env.VAR_NAME)
|
|
)
|
|
|
|
print("\nCreating agent from YAML definition...")
|
|
agent = factory.create_agent_from_yaml(YAML_OPENAI_WITH_API_KEY)
|
|
|
|
async with agent:
|
|
query = "What is my GitHub username?"
|
|
print(f"\nUser: {query}")
|
|
response = await agent.run(query)
|
|
print(f"\nAgent: {response.text}")
|
|
|
|
|
|
async def run_azure_ai_example():
|
|
"""Run the Azure AI example with Foundry connection.
|
|
|
|
Prerequisites:
|
|
1. Create a Foundry connection named 'github-mcp-oauth-connection' in your
|
|
Azure AI project with OAuth credentials for GitHub
|
|
2. Set PROJECT_ENDPOINT environment variable to your Azure AI project endpoint
|
|
"""
|
|
print("=" * 60)
|
|
print("Example 2: Azure AI with Foundry Connection Reference")
|
|
print("=" * 60)
|
|
|
|
from azure.identity import DefaultAzureCredential
|
|
|
|
factory = AgentFactory(client_kwargs={"credential": DefaultAzureCredential()})
|
|
|
|
print("\nCreating agent from YAML definition...")
|
|
# Use async method for provider-based agent creation
|
|
agent = await factory.create_agent_from_yaml_async(YAML_AZURE_AI_WITH_FOUNDRY_CONNECTION)
|
|
|
|
async with agent:
|
|
query = "What is my GitHub username?"
|
|
print(f"\nUser: {query}")
|
|
response = await agent.run(query)
|
|
print(f"\nAgent: {response.text}")
|
|
|
|
|
|
async def main():
|
|
"""Run the MCP tool examples."""
|
|
# Run the OpenAI example
|
|
await run_openai_example()
|
|
|
|
# Run the Azure AI example (uncomment to run)
|
|
# Requires: Foundry connection set up and PROJECT_ENDPOINT env var
|
|
# await run_azure_ai_example()
|
|
|
|
|
|
if __name__ == "__main__":
|
|
asyncio.run(main())
